Monitor the designated swimming area to detect hazardous situations, unusual or unsafe activities, and swimmers experiencing difficulty. Promote recreational facility rules and regulations. Identify situations where guests cannot safely participate in an activity and report to a supervisor/manager. Provide assistance to injured guests until emergency medical services arrive. Promote a cheerful and comfortable environment for guests. Fold, stack, and distribute towels according to company procedures. Wash, scrub, and clean the pool perimeter area. Report accidents, injuries, and hazardous working conditions to management; complete safety training and obtain required certifications. Move, lift, carry, push, pull, and place objects weighing less than 50 pounds (22.50 kg) or equivalent without assistance. Assist in moving, lifting, carrying, and placing objects weighing more than 75 pounds (33.75 kg). Stand, sit, or walk for extended periods or throughout full work shifts. Move at speeds required to respond to job-related situations (e.g., running, walking, jogging). Visually inspect tools, equipment, or machinery (e.g., to identify defects). Grasp, turn, and manipulate objects of various sizes and weights, requiring fine motor skills and good hand-eye coordination. Reach above shoulder height and below knee level, including bending, twisting waist, pulling, and stooping. Navigate inclined, uneven, or slippery surfaces and stairways. Climb and descend ladders.
